About Yasmin Rustamova

Yasmin Rustamova is a scholar working on Internal Medicine, Obstetrics and Gynecology and Cardiology and Cardiovascular Medicine, having authored 7 papers that have together received 65 indexed citations. Recurring topics across this work include Cardiac Imaging and Diagnostics (2 papers), COVID-19 Impact on Reproduction (2 papers), COVID-19 and healthcare impacts (2 papers), COVID-19 and Mental Health (1 paper), Cardiac Fibrosis and Remodeling (1 paper), Cardiac pacing and defibrillation studies (1 paper), Inflammatory Biomarkers in Disease Prognosis (1 paper) and Heart Failure Treatment and Management (1 paper). The work is most often cited by research in Cardiology and Cardiovascular Medicine (39 citations), Internal Medicine (3 citations) and Endocrinology, Diabetes and Metabolism (8 citations). Yasmin Rustamova has collaborated with scholars based in Azerbaijan, Egypt and Italy. Frequent co-authors include Andreas P. Kalogeropoulos, Stylianos Tzeis, Panos Vardas, A. E. Soloveva, Anastasia Shchendrygina, Amina Rakisheva, Nunzia Borrelli, Katarzyna Czerwińska, Abdallah Almaghraby and Julia Grapsa. Their work appears in journals such as European Journal of Heart Failure, International Journal of Cardiology, Journal of Cardiovascular Magnetic Resonance, Cardiac failure review and Revista română de medicină de laborator.
